Кои са програмните езици, необходими за изграждане на добър сайт?

Share

Когато обмисляме създаването на сайт, множеството програмни езици, с които трябва да се справим, могат да изглеждат доста сложна задача. Всеки от тях има своята роля в общата картина на разработката на сайт. С помощта на специалисти от CodeAcademy ще разгледаме някои от основните езици, както и техните предимства при разработката на онлайн проекти. Колко време отнема да ги научите – прочети повече .

Програмни езици за дизайн и интерактивност на интерфейса

Съвременният интерфейс се изисква да бъде не само визуално привлекателен, но и функционален, адаптивен към различни устройства и интуитивен за потребителя. При изграждането на такъв интерфейс, ключова роля играят програмните езици, свързани с предната част (front-end) на сайта.

  • HTML – служи за гръбнак на уеб страницата. Той определя структурните елементи като заглавия, параграфи, линкове и множество други. Всеки модерен сайт е базиран на HTML, който служи като основа, върху която другите технологии могат да допринесат за богатството и функционалността на страницата;
  • CSS – дава живот на HTML структурата, придавайки ? цвят, форма и анимация. С CSS можем да контролираме всеки пиксел от дизайна – от фонови цветове и шрифтове до комплексни анимации и преходи;
  • JavaScript – внася динамиката в уеб страницата. Това е езикът, който позволява създаването на интерактивни елементи като падащи менюта, слайдери, анимирани ефекти и др.

Когато говорим за предната част на сайта, тримата главни актьори – HTML, CSS и JavaScript – работят съвместно, за да предоставят богат, интуитивен и отзивчив материал на потребителя.

Програмни езици за задната част на сайта (Back-end) и тяхната роля в уеб разработката

Задната част на сайта (Back-end) е мястото, където се обработват данните, управляват се базите данни и се осигурява комуникацията между сървъра и браузъра. Разработката на задната част изисква специфични знания и умения, които са различни от тези за предната част, и е базирана на следните ключови програмни езици:

  • PHP – използва се за създаване на динамични сайтове и приложения. Той работи в комбинация с бази данни като MySQL, което позволява на разработчиците да създават сложни и функционални онлайн платформи;
  • SQL – с него разработчиците могат да изпълняват заявки – да добавят, изтриват, модифицират или извличат информация. Почти всяка динамична функция – като вход на потребител или публикуване на новина – изисква комуникация с база данни, която се управлява чрез SQL.

Задната част на сайта е изключително важна за функционалността и надеждността на всяко онлайн присъствие. Изборът на подходящите програмни езици и технологии е решаващ за успешната реализация на всяка уеб платформа или приложение.

Как платформите и инструментите оптимизират ефективността в уеб разработката?

В уеб разработката, освен знанието на програмни езици, ключова роля играят и специализираните платформи и инструменти. Те автоматизират и оптимизират работни процеси, улесняват сътрудничеството между разработчиците и осигуряват стабилност на проектите. Платформи като WordPress предлагат гъвкавост чрез готови шаблони, което улеснява писането и управлението на съдържание, докато други, като GitHub, подпомагат ефективната комуникация и интеграция на кода. Облачните решения като AWS от своя страна осигуряват надеждно и бързо хостинг решение.

Подобни статии

Не пропускайте